		<description>[...] Canario, 49, was arrested September 22 and held on $20,000 bond after she refused to leave one of the Fort Trumbull homes in New London, Conn., which had been seized using eminent domain. She was protesting the taking of the neighborhood for private economic development. [...]</description>

		<description>[...] Canario was arrested September 22 and has been held since her arrest at York Correctional Institute for Women in Niantic. Canario has engaged in classic nonviolent civil disobedience by remaining silent and going limp whenever police or other officials want her to move somewhere. [...]</description>
